576m
25/6141Invalid - Case Closed10 Oct 2025

10 Year planning permission for the development of a solar farm consisting of approximately 37,268.29m of solar panels mounted on ground-mounted frames, 24 no. electrical inverters, 1 no. electrical transformer unit, security fencing, landscaping, underground cabling crossing through the L7694 public road extending into private land and all associated ancillary development works. The project represents an extension to the solar farm permitted under Cork County Council planning references 18/6769, 19/5729, 19/6882 and 21/4050. The Solar Farm will have an operational lifespan of 35 years. A Natura Impact Statement (NIS) has been prepared and will be submitted to the planning authority with the application. The Development is covered by the provisions of the Renewable Energy Directive III (Directive (EU)2023/2413) and it is important to note that the planning application may be subject to section 34D of the Planning and Development Act 2000, as amended.

Ballycurrany East, Barrymore, Co. Cork
